Transaction 6540cf7115dadca04b572c628bc1537bf9e90b017f85655577002cfa6a0e78d1
1 Input
1 Output
-
6540cf7115dadca04b572c628bc1537bf9e90b017f85655577002cfa6a0e78d1:0
- value
- 384450
- script pubkey
- OP_0 OP_PUSHBYTES_20 1a2c7cbaf240d734fe87608397c6a06ac387a273
- address
- bc1qrgk8ewhjgrtnfl58vzpe034qdtpc0gnngy7kqf